Here’s How Kaia Gerber Transformed Into Jane Birkin for Halloween

This year, Halloween returned in full swing, and with it came a renewed commitment to high-impact costumes. And from Hailey Bieber’s impressive Britney Spears retrospective to Yara Shahidi’s Aaliyah, 2021 was all about the style-minded homage. For Kaia Gerber, this meant reuniting with makeup artist Sam Visser and hairstylist Chârlie Le Mindu to re-create the mane and visage of ‘60s and 70s (and eternal) icon Jane Birkin.
“I think she had a very relaxed yet put together appeal,” says Visser of Birkin. “Her makeup was quite effortless—when she’d apply the lashes and lines through the crease it was always simple and never felt overdone. Simplicity was her elegance.” To help Gerber channel Birkin, the artist opted for an interpretation of one of Birkin’s more dramatic moments, focusing on eye-encasing liner and drawn-on lashes—all while keeping the look soft and aspirational. And with a pin-straight honeyed mane, replete with full bangs and sleek, glossy texture, the transformation was truly one that, even with its bevy of retro cues, felt entirely current. “Jane Birkin used to say that you don’t need makeup, as a smile will take ten years off your face—Kaia has that smile," says Le Mindu.
